A water fed pole enables cleaners to reach upper levels safely while remaining firmly on the ground. Purified water flows through the pole to a brush head, breaking down dirt and rinsing it away for a clear, streak-free finish. This method is widely used for cleaning windows, UPVC frames, cladding, signage, and solar panels. Removing the need for ladders greatly reduces the chance of accidents and allows cleaners to work with greater confidence at height. Ground-based operation also improves control, making it easier to apply even pressure and reach awkward angles. For cleaning businesses, this translates into faster jobs, reduced physical strain, and improved safety compliance.
